How Our Document Drying Services in Covington, WA Work

Our team’s process for Document Drying Services is designed to get the job done quickly and effectively. We understand that every minute counts with saving your precious documents. That’s why we’re available 24/7 to respond to your emergency and start the restoration process within 60 minutes.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will assess the damage and create a personalized plan to dry and restore your documents. This includes identifying the source of the water damage and containing the area to prevent further harm.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ment, such as industrial-grade pumps and water extraction vacuums to remove the water from your documents and the surrounding area.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our team will use high-velocity fans and dehumidifiers to dry your documents and the surrounding area. This process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Restoration

Once your documents are dry, our technicians will clean and restore them to their original condition. This may involve disinfecting and deodorizing the documents to remove any bacteria or unpleasant odors.

Step 5: Monitoring and Completion

We’ll monitor the drying process and make any necessary adjustments to ensure your documents are completely dry and restored to their original condition. Once the job is complete, we’ll provide you with a final inspection and quality assurance.

Document Drying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on a single document Yes No Easy to clean and dry yourself
Widespread water damage in a large document collection No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ise
Musty odors or water stains on documents No Yes Shows water damage and needs professional attention
Discoloration or warping on documents No Yes Signs of water damage and needs professional restoration
Water damage in a sensitive or historic document collection No Yes Needs specialized care and handling to prevent further damage
